Subject: [PATCH 1/2] KVM: arm64: Fix sign-extension of MMIO loads

A sign-extending load from MMIO (LDRSB, LDRSH, LDRSW) delivers a
zero-extended value: in kvm_handle_mmio_return(), vcpu_data_host_to_guest()
masks the data to the access width after sign-extension, stripping the
sign bits.

Move vcpu_data_host_to_guest() ahead of sign-extension so the width mask
runs first. trace_kvm_mmio() moves with it and keeps reporting the raw
access-width data.

Fixes: b30070862edbd ("ARM64: KVM: MMIO support BE host running LE code")
Signed-off-by: Fuad Tabba <fuad.tabba@linux.dev>
---
 arch/arm64/kvm/mmio.c | 7 ++++---
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m64/kvm/mmio.c b/arch/arm64/kvm/mmio.c
index e2285ed8c91de..d1c3a352d5a22 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kvm/mmio.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kvm/mmio.c
@@ -126,6 +126,10 @@ int kvm_handle_mmio_return(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 		len = kvm_vcpu_dabt_get_as(vcpu);
 		data = kvm_mmio_read_buf(run->mmio.data, len);
 
+		trace_kvm_mmio(KVM_TRACE_MMIO_READ, len, run->mmio.phys_addr,
+			       &data);
+		data = vcpu_data_host_to_guest(vcpu, data, len);
+
 		if (kvm_vcpu_dabt_issext(vcpu) &&
 		    len < sizeof(unsigned long)) {
 			mask = 1U << ((len * 8) - 1);
@@ -135,9 +139,6 @@ int kvm_handle_mmio_return(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 		if (!kvm_vcpu_dabt_issf(vcpu))
 			data = data & 0xffffffff;
 
-		trace_kvm_mmio(KVM_TRACE_MMIO_READ, len, run->mmio.phys_addr,
-			       &data);
-		data = vcpu_data_host_to_guest(vcpu, data, len);
 		vcpu_set_reg(vcpu, kvm_vcpu_dabt_get_rd(vcpu), data);
 	}
